Exploring the Critical Role of Stud and Track Machines in Modern Construction

In the evolving world of construction, innovative tools and equipment play a pivotal role in enhancing efficiency, safety, and precision. Among these, the stud and track machine stands out as a cornerstone technology revolutionizing metal framing. These machines are integral in creating robust and durable metal studs and tracks, which are essential components used extensively in wall partitions and ceiling frames.
